Question 307652: A set of data with a mean of 60 and a standard deviation of 5.4 is normally distributed. Find the values that are 1 standard deviation from the mean.

a# –5.4 and 65.4
b# 54.6 and 65.4
c# –5.4 and 5.4
d# 5.4 and 65.4

60-5.4=54.6
60+5.4=65.4
The answer is B).
